/*
* cstring.i
* $Header: /cvsroot/swig/SWIG/Lib/python/cwstring.i,v 1.1 2005/09/06 06:22:10 marcelomatus Exp $
*
* This file provides typemaps and macros for dealing with various forms
* of C character string handling. The primary use of this module
* is in returning character data that has been allocated or changed in
* some way.
*/
/*
* %cwstring_input_binary(TYPEMAP, SIZE)
*
* Macro makes a function accept binary string data along with
* a size.
*/
/*
* %cwstring_bounded_output(TYPEMAP, MAX)
*
* This macro is used to return a NULL-terminated output string of
* some maximum length. For example:
*
* %cwstring_bounded_output(wchar_t *outx, 512);
* void foo(wchar_t *outx) {
* sprintf(outx,"blah blah\n");
* }
*
*/
/*
* %cwstring_chunk_output(TYPEMAP, SIZE)
*
* This macro is used to return a chunk of binary string data.
* Embedded NULLs are okay. For example:
*
* %cwstring_chunk_output(wchar_t *outx, 512);
* void foo(wchar_t *outx) {
* memmove(outx, somedata, 512);
* }
*
*/
/*
* %cwstring_bounded_mutable(TYPEMAP, SIZE)
*
* This macro is used to wrap a string that's going to mutate.
*
* %cwstring_bounded_mutable(wchar_t *in, 512);
* void foo(in *x) {
* while (*x) {
* *x = toupper(*x);
* x++;
* }
* }
*
*/
/*
* %cwstring_mutable(TYPEMAP [, expansion])
*
* This macro is used to wrap a string that will mutate in place.
* It may change size up to a user-defined expansion.
*
* %cwstring_mutable(wchar_t *in);
* void foo(in *x) {
* while (*x) {
* *x = toupper(*x);
* x++;
* }
* }
*
*/
/*
* %cwstring_output_maxsize(TYPEMAP, SIZE)
*
* This macro returns data in a string of some user-defined size.
*
* %cwstring_output_maxsize(wchar_t *outx, int max) {
* void foo(wchar_t *outx, int max) {
* sprintf(outx,"blah blah\n");
* }
*/
/*
* %cwstring_output_withsize(TYPEMAP, SIZE)
*
* This macro is used to return wchar_tacter data along with a size
* parameter.
*
* %cwstring_output_maxsize(wchar_t *outx, int *max) {
* void foo(wchar_t *outx, int *max) {
* sprintf(outx,"blah blah\n");
* *max = strlen(outx);
* }
*/
/*
* %cwstring_output_allocate(TYPEMAP, RELEASE)
*
* This macro is used to return wchar_tacter data that was
* allocated with new or malloc.
*
* %cwstring_output_allocated(wchar_t **outx, free($1));
* void foo(wchar_t **outx) {
* *outx = (wchar_t *) malloc(512);
* sprintf(outx,"blah blah\n");
* }
*/
/*
* %cwstring_output_allocate_size(TYPEMAP, SIZE, RELEASE)
*
* This macro is used to return wchar_tacter data that was
* allocated with new or malloc.
*
* %cwstring_output_allocated(wchar_t **outx, int *sz, free($1));
* void foo(wchar_t **outx, int *sz) {
* *outx = (wchar_t *) malloc(512);
* sprintf(outx,"blah blah\n");
* *sz = strlen(outx);
* }
*/
